I’d like to thank the staff of the thrift store for my newly acquired typewriter. It’s a manual job from the 1950s, complete with case and in beautiful condition. Best of all was the price: nothing—it was in the Dumpster. On the shelves inside the store were the items that were deemed sellable, including a suitcase with the handle and wheels broken off (price: $8) and a software box (no software inside) for $2.99. But a perfectly-functioning antique typewriter was Dumpsterized. Maybe they figured it was broken, since it had no cord!
